Identifying the Voltage Requirements: Deciphering Your Oven’s Needs

Before purchasing or installing an electric oven, it is essential to determine its voltage requirements. This information can typically be found on the appliance’s specification label, which is usually affixed to the back or bottom of the oven. The label will clearly indicate the voltage (e.g., 120V or 240V) and amperage (e.g., 20A or 30A) required for safe operation.

Electrical Safety: Ensuring a Safe Kitchen Environment

When dealing with high-voltage electrical appliances like electric ovens, safety should always be the top priority. Here are some essential electrical safety tips:

  • Consult a Qualified Electrician: Always seek the assistance of a licensed electrician for the installation, repair, or modification of electrical appliances, including electric ovens.
  • Proper Grounding: Ensure that the oven is properly grounded to prevent electrical shocks and protect against electrical faults.
  • Circuit Protection: Install an appropriate circuit breaker or fuse to protect the electrical circuit powering the oven from overloads and short circuits.
  • Regular Maintenance: Schedule regular maintenance checks by a qualified technician to ensure the continued safe and efficient operation of your electric oven.

Q: Can I use a 220-volt oven on a 120-volt circuit?
A: No, operating a 220-volt oven on a 120-volt circuit is dangerous and can damage the oven. It is essential to ensure that the voltage requirements of your oven match the electrical capacity of your home.

Q: How do I know if my home has 220-volt wiring?
A: Check your electrical panel for circuit breakers or fuses labeled 220V or 240V. You can also use a voltage tester to measure the voltage at an outlet.
